Brand: Wieland

Description:

The Wieland R1.190.1000.0 Memory SP-COP-CARD1 is an industrial memory card module used in automation and control systems for program storage and data backup functions. Commonly installed in PLC systems, industrial controllers, automation equipment, and machine control assemblies requiring secure configuration and memory retention capabilities. Maintenance technicians, OEM machine builders, and system integrators use this memory card for controller backups, system replacement, and industrial automation retrofit applications.

Applications:

The Wieland SP-COP-CARD1 memory module is designed for industrial data storage and configuration management in demanding automation environments. It is frequently used in manufacturing systems, packaging machinery, process automation equipment, conveyor controls, and factory automation systems where reliable memory storage and fast controller restoration are critical for minimizing downtime and maintaining operational continuity.
